As a Software Engineer I at JPMorgan Chase within the Risk Management and Compliance specifically in the Model Risk Governance & Review (MRGR) team you will be developing tools for MRGR Analytics to improve efficiency and reduce duplication of effort including resource management and cost optimization tools. You will provide support for model reviewers and governance teams in building independent testing and efficiency tools. You will be delivering highquality solutions by emphasizing the importance of data controls testing user experience and continuously seek input from users to align efforts with their objectives.

Bring your expertise to JPMorganChase. As part of Risk Management and Compliance you are at the center of keeping JPMorganChase strong and resilient.MRGR is a global team of modeling experts within the firms Risk Management and Compliance organization. The team is responsible for conducting independent model validation and model governance activities to help identify measure and mitigate Model Risk in the firm. Within MRGR the Chief Operating Office (COO) supports model risk stakeholders in their review and governance activities and drives certain governance activities itself with responsibility for: product ownership process engineering and software development for model risk technology and analytics; model risk reporting; administration of oversight committees; project management of the review and governance pipeline; coordination of regulatory/audit deliverables including capital stress testing exercises; and general business management. Within COO MRGR Analyticsprovides technology solutions for MRGR and its clients assisting them in performing their tasks more efficiently accurately and with better control. Majority of the solutions are built within Athena (JPMorganChases proprietary framework using Python language) Tableau and QlikView/QlikSense frameworks.

Job responsibilities

  • Develop tools to automate various tasks in the model governance and review lifecycle.
  • Build various dashboard reports to help manage the body of work that MRGR deals with.
  • Translate the existing business requirements in model risk management space into business applications using applied development work mostly in Python using inhouse built Python framework.
  • Build intelligent solutions to support the activities of MRGR staff.

Required qualifications capabilities and skills

  • A Bachelors or Masters degree in a Science Technology Engineering or Mathematics discipline with significant exposure to computer programming.
  • Minimum 2 years of full stack application development.
  • Proficient in Python and knowledge of Tornado web framework / TypeScript / React required.
  • Good understanding of software architecture objectoriented programming and design patterns.
  • Strong communication skills with the ability to interface with other functional areas in the firm on business requirements.
  • Risk and control mindset: ability to think critically assess user needs and create design solutions to meet user needs.

Preferred qualifications capabilities and skills

  • Experience in working with large data sets.
  • Strong UI/UX designing skills.
  • Experience in model risk management or financial services space.
